The journey through an injury lawsuit can be broken down into numerous key phases:

Consultation: Initial conference with the lawyer to talk about the information of the case and evaluate its merits.

Examination: Gathering evidence, speaking with witnesses, and acquiring medical records to build a strong case.

Filing a Claim: Submitting a claim to the insurer or straight submitting a lawsuit.

Negotiation: Engaging in discussions with the insurance business to reach a reasonable settlement.

Litigation: If negotiations stop working, the case might continue to court, where both sides present their arguments.

Resolution: The case concludes either through a settlement or a court verdict, identifying the compensation awarded.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Just how much does it cost to hire an injury lawsuit lawyer?
A lot of injury lawsuit attorneys work on a contingency fee basis, implying they just make money if you win your case. Their fees generally vary from 25% to 40% of the settlement or award, depending on the case's intricacy.
2. The length of time do I have to submit an injury lawsuit?
Each state has its statute of limitations, which is the time limit for filing a lawsuit. Usually, this varies from one to 4 years from the date of the injury, so it's essential to act immediately.

What if I am partially at fault for the accident?
In lots of jurisdictions, you can still recuperate damages even if you share some fault for the Accident Injury Law Firm. However, your compensation may be reduced by the portion of your fault.
5. The length of time does an injury lawsuit take to deal with?
The period of an injury lawsuit can differ extensively based on numerous factors, consisting of the intricacy of the case, the desire of both parties to work out, and court schedules. Some cases settle within a few months, while others can take years to fix.
